Boise Ant Prevention Tips
Seal cracks in your Boise home's foundation and around windows, as the dry climate causes soil to shift and create entry points for ants. Keep mulch and vegetation at least 12 inches from your Boise home's exterior, as the low humidity makes ants seek moisture near foundations. Store firewood and debris away from your Boise property, since the cold winter lows drive ants to nest in these sheltered spots.
